Helicopter tours
Check on which companies are still permitted to fly lower
over Na Pali, as it is now very limited.
The type of aircraft
they use is also important. The Bell Jet Ranger seats 1
passenger in front, with a glass floor, and 3 in back with
windows that
open
for photography. The Hughes 500-D seats 2 in front by the pilot and 2 in back,
without opening windows. TheA-star seats 2 in front and 4 in the rear, with
the center seats having a more limited view.
Hiking
Kukui Trail: This 5-mile (RT) trail
to a swimming hole at the bottom of spectacular Waimea
Canyon, off the Iliau Loop Trail. The canyon also now has
a boardwalk through the Alakai Swamp.
Kuilau Ridge Trail: This 4.2-mile (RT)
hike offers dramatic views of small waterfalls and a wealth
of flora, a mile beyond the Uof
H Agr. Exper. Station on Route 580.
Kalalau Trail: Choose 1 to 30-mile (RT)
hikes, in the Na Pali. wilderness, from Ke'e
Beach, offering spectacular views of land and sea.
